Flash train-logic

The concieved notion that you can accomplish anything, simply because it is required of you in that moment. Even if you have no background of doing this or there's been no setup for you being able to do this in the past.
Basically a lousy way to explain away a Deus Ex Machina.
As seen on the Flash:
The Flash somehow manages to get a train to vibrate at the same speed he is, so that the train goes through some rubble in the road.
Later:
Kid Flash: "How did you do that?"
Flash: "Because I had to."
Me, watching the show: That's some Flash train-logic right there!"
by BoxerJoe June 02, 2017
Get the Flash train-logic mug.

Flash track

Flash track refers to the next level of a "fast track" project whereby the schedule stretches the limits of what is possible to do in the time framed allowed.
Person 1: This is a flash track"projet.
Person 2: Don't you mean FAST track?
Person 1: No, this project needs to be done faster than fast.
by hendjeeneer August 25, 2017
Get the Flash track mug.

Flash Tan

When you take a selfie on snapchat and the flash is on there for making you look pale as Casper
I had really good lighting and a great angle but it was all a waste because of an accidental flash tan
by Netflix4lyfe January 21, 2016
Get the Flash Tan mug.

Flash Trash

Used to describe people with loads of money who still dress like they are trailer trash.
Pamela Anderson is the epitome of Flash Trash
by LMDQ February 06, 2010
Get the Flash Trash mug.

Flashed on

To go off on someone for being a dumbass
James flashed on Eddie for being an idiot.
by Nay Bella January 11, 2020
Get the Flashed on mug.

flash hey

Flash hey can also be referred to as a dry text to start a conversation. It would consist of just "hey" and nothing else. This is utilized by someone who is feeling sassy or annoyed with the other person. They want to talk to them but at the same time they are bothered that the other person did not initiate first.
Person 1: "Hey"
Person 2: "No need for the flash hey, I've been busy"
by queenofsass13 January 17, 2017
Get the flash hey mug.